A comprehensive, high-potency, hypoallergenic vitamin supplement in three capsules daily, LDA Multi-Vitamin has been formulated with higher strength amounts and specific ratios of essential vitamins compared to other Klaire multivitamin formulas. Activated forms of folate (5-methyltetrahydrofolate and folinic acid) and vitamin B12 (methylcobalamin and 5-adenosylcobalamin) are used for enhanced absorption and bioactivity. LDA Multi-Vitamin should be taken with food.
Suggested Use: As a dietary supplement take three capsules daily or as directed by a physician.
